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031
In the year 2024, the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market was valued at USD 3,591.75 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 4,139.97 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 2.1%.
The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market is poised for substantial growth, driven by advancements in healthcare technology, rising prevalence of blood disorders, and increasing awareness regarding the importance of hematocrit testing in diagnostic procedures. Hematocrit tests, which measure the proportion of red blood cells in the blood, play a critical role in diagnosing conditions such as anemia, polycythemia, and dehydration. With the escalating demand for point-of-care testing and the development of portable hematocrit test devices, healthcare providers can efficiently monitor patients' hematocrit levels in diverse clinical settings, thereby enhancing patient care and treatment outcomes.

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market Recent Developments
-
In April 2022, Sysmex Europe introduced the XQ-320, a new three-part differential automated hematology analyzer. This cutting-edge device offers quality excellence and enhanced usability, catering to diverse clinical laboratory settings with reliable technology.
-
In March 2022, Mindray launched the BC-700 Series, an Integrated CBC and ESR hematology analyzer designed for small-to-mid-sized laboratories. This innovative solution provides comprehensive testing capabilities, empowering laboratories to efficiently meet their diagnostic needs.
Segment Analysis
The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market is segmented by Product, Application, and End Users, with each category addressing different aspects of hematocrit testing for various medical conditions and healthcare settings. In the Product segment, the market includes Blood Analyzers, Hematocrit Test Meters, and Others. Blood Analyzers are widely used in laboratories and hospitals for comprehensive blood tests, offering automated and accurate hematocrit measurements along with other blood parameters. These devices are often part of larger diagnostic equipment used for routine check-ups or specialized testing. Hematocrit Test Meters, on the other hand, are portable devices designed for quick and direct measurement of hematocrit levels at the point of care. These are particularly useful in emergency settings, clinics, and fieldwork where fast results are essential. The Others category includes additional devices and technologies used for hematocrit testing, such as centrifuges and manual testing tools, offering flexibility in different clinical settings.
In the Application segment, the market is divided into Lymphoma, Leukemia, Anemia, Congenital Heart Diseases, and Others. Lymphoma and Leukemia are cancers that affect the blood and bone marrow, and hematocrit tests play a crucial role in diagnosing and monitoring the progression of these diseases. These tests help assess the impact of the diseases on red blood cell production and overall blood health. Anemia, a condition characterized by insufficient red blood cells or hemoglobin, is one of the most common applications for hematocrit testing. The test is critical in diagnosing different types of anemia, from nutritional deficiencies to chronic diseases, and is essential for ongoing monitoring of treatment efficacy. In Congenital Heart Diseases, hematocrit tests help evaluate blood oxygen levels and monitor the overall circulatory health of patients, assisting in the management of congenital heart defects. The Others category encompasses various conditions, such as kidney diseases and dehydration, where hematocrit levels provide valuable diagnostic insights.

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market, Segmentation by Application
The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market has been segmented by Application into Lymphoma, Leukemia, Anemia, Congenital Heart Diseases, and Others.
The Global Hematocrit Test Devices Market is segmented by Application into several key areas, including Lymphoma, Leukemia, Anemia, Congenital Heart Diseases, and Others, each representing different hematologic and cardiovascular conditions that require accurate blood analysis. Lymphoma and Leukemia are cancers of the blood and bone marrow, where hematocrit tests play an important role in diagnosing and monitoring treatment responses. These tests help to determine red blood cell count, which can be affected by the abnormal growth of white blood cells in these cancers, providing essential information for clinicians in managing patient care.
Anemia is one of the most common applications for hematocrit tests. This condition, characterized by a low red blood cell count or hemoglobin levels, can be diagnosed and monitored through hematocrit testing. The test helps determine the severity of anemia and aids in identifying its underlying causes, whether related to nutritional deficiencies, chronic diseases, or other factors. Anemia testing is commonly performed in routine check-ups, especially in vulnerable populations such as children, the elderly, and pregnant women. Hematocrit tests are also essential in assessing the effectiveness of treatments such as iron supplements or erythropoiesis-stimulating agents.
The Congenital Heart Diseases segment represents another critical application area, as hematocrit tests can help identify abnormal blood flow and oxygenation issues in patients with congenital heart defects. Hematocrit levels can provide valuable insights into the severity of the disease and the body’s ability to deliver oxygen throughout the circulatory system. The Others category includes a variety of other medical conditions where hematocrit levels are important, such as dehydration, kidney disease, and heart failure. Hematocrit tests are used across these diverse conditions to monitor fluid balance, assess the effects of treatments, and provide essential diagnostic information, making them a versatile tool in clinical practice.
